Transaction e4d29a31d7883c91503388ad8ff868b126403a4b1bedbec2ce84d3f21f7743fb
1 Input
1 Output
-
e4d29a31d7883c91503388ad8ff868b126403a4b1bedbec2ce84d3f21f7743fb:0
- value
- 3700666
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21c3bc31b474cd8f8277f80126a89de30755134d OP_EQUALVERIFY OP_CHECKSIG
- address
- 145XnFGCZoKyuZTSZzCdTc4cymuQ915xgj